Dec 15, 2015 a study of moderate and severe amblyopia treatment found approximately 25% of patients under age seven had a recurrence of amblyopia within the first year of stopping treatment, and children ages seven to 12 had a 7% chance of recurrence worsening of two lines of visual acuity. Our experience in the ongoing amblyopia treatment study, in which the acuity protocol is being used at 52 sites recruiting 400 children, is that with simple instruction, testers learn to follow the protocol quickly, and errors affecting the visual acuity score are few. The pediatric eye disease investigator group pedig is a clinical network of pediatric optometrists and ophthalmologists funded by the national eye institute to conduct clinical research studies related to pediatric eye conditions. To complement the primary study endpoint, ie, improvement in visual acuity, we developed the amblyopia treatment index ati as a survey instrument to assess the acceptability of treatment and its impact on the child and family. It is important to note that in all of the pedig amblyopia treatment trials, children with a visually significant anatomic abnormality or prior history of intraocular surgery were excluded from study. Amblyopia treatment study ats 12 a randomized trial comparing patching with active vision therapy to patching with control vision therapy as treatment for amblyopia in children 7 to amblyopia 612660 were randomly assigned to receive either 2 hours of daily patching with active vision therapy or 2 hours of daily patching with placebo vision therapy.
